Default Ok, my 91/30 is starting to piss me off.

I've been through 3 cleaning sessions and it's not getting any cleaner.

Brush the hell out of it with my brass brush, run tons of patches through it (100-200). After the brush, the patches come out pitch black. Regardless of the brush, they still come out dirty with no change in color at all. What the hell is going on?

I just oiled it up and left it sitting. I don't have the patience for this anymore.

Is this just a really, really dirty Mosin? The patches are only black in color.

Default Re: Ok, my 91/30 is starting to piss me off.

I work on and clean guns every day here at the shop. And in all the time of doing so I've seen or heard of guys doing this " I clean it and clean it, and still dirty " the best thing to do is make sure it has nothing blocking the barrel and take it out and shoot it. then go back and clean it . I scrubbed a yugo sks for about an hour( thought we got srewed and it was shot out) and it still looked like shit, took it out put 3 shots down range and then ran a couple of patches till they came out spotless. nothing cleans grooves better than something running them and your brush brass or synt. doesn't run them quite as nice as a bullet.

Default Re: Ok, my 91/30 is starting to piss me off.

I ran across this problem with my 91/30 also. I stripped the whole thing to pieces then soaked the barrel in HOT soapy water for about 30 - 45 minutes, dried it throughly and then cleaned it like I normally do with Weapon Shield, brush and patches.

Default Re: Ok, my 91/30 is starting to piss me off.

I probably ran 100 or so patches through it before the soapy water treatment. 30 minutes or so won't rust it as long as you dry it throughly after soaking.

Milsurp rounds should be cleaned immediately after shooting, if not, it could cause fouling that could be near impossible to clean out.
